In 2024, insurers led the distribution of combined insurance, followed by price comparison websites (PCWs). Sales via banks and PCWs grew by 0.6 percentage points (pp) and 1pp, respectively, in 2024. These increases are likely due to banks enhancing their digital presence in this product space, as well as consumers being increasingly focused on premium pricing amid the UK’s cost-of-living crisis.

• In the combined insurance segment, all research methods saw an uptick in usage in 2024 compared to 2023, with the exception of customers calling their existing provider for combined insurance policies. This highlights that consumers are increasingly trying to find the best deals as premiums increase and the cost-of-living crisis persists.
• 41.6% of customers chose to renew their combined policy with their current insurer after comparing prices, while 28.7% automatically renewed. In both cases, this represented a 0.3pp decline compared to 2023.
• In 2024, four providers featured within the top 10 across all three household insurance segments: Aviva, Admiral, AXA/AXA Assistance, and LV=.
